I am going to Puerto Rico in less than 2 months and I just wanted to know what kind of exercises to do to lose as much weight as I can a.s.a.p. I had a baby about 9 months ago and I just want to look decent in a bathing suit ya know? Please give me any and all suggestions!

Seriously, the best type of excercise is whatever you actually enjoy. It is best for your body to engage in varied activities anyhow. I recommend going to your local library to check out their workout videos. Pick out various titles and give them a try to see what you like best and what matches your fitness level. Once you figure that out, you can buy some videos to have on hand. Also think about what sorts of active hobbies interest you. Bike riding, hiking, dancing (can do it in your living room), long brisk walks, roller blading, playing frisbee or volleyball at the park... of course the list goes on and on. Anything that gets the heart rate up is good for losing fat, and I find Pilates to be the best for strength training and stretching. Watch your diet, though. Lots of people who start working out/living a more active lifestyle consume waaaaaay more calories without even thinking about it. Obviously you don't want to deprive your body of the sustenance it needs, but if you consume as many more calories as you're burning, you won't see the weight come off (although you will still be healthier). Good luck!

I've tried every form of exercise and the most effective for me was when I tried light weight training. It only took 15 minutes of lifting light weights 3 times a week, combined with walking (light cardio) 3 times a week. I watched what I ate and I lost 20 lbs in 3 months.

I was told that if you build a layer of lean muscle mass under your fat layer, it's the best way to burn that fat layer away. You can actually burn away the fat while you're at rest too.

You didn't indicate if you have access to a gym or not - this is critical to know if we're going to recommend some routines for you to do. If you do (and I hope you do), then consider something like the elliptical machine. This is a fairly effective cardio machine that burns calories a lot faster than, say, the treadmill. It also delivers more of a total body workout, and most people who use it report seeing results fairly fast. Clean up your diet, too - avoid refined sugars, and eat plenty of fruits, vegetables and lean protein sources.
